Books to Go
Books to Go sets up lending libraries in schools so children can dream big and families can read together.

Read moreSolar Libraries
In places where few homes have electricity, Solar Libraries give children the chance to keep reading after the sun goes down.

Read moreCommunity Container Libraries
Each Community Container Library transforms a disused shipping container into a thriving library for the whole community.
